French rally driver René Zereni, 26, was killed during the fifth edition of the Ronde Automobile de Calvi - Galeria - Calvenzana, on Sunday, 23 September 1984.

His #62 Peugeot 205 GTI 1.6 went out of control on a fast stretch of road, during a special stage of the rally. The car left the road, fell into a ravine and caught fire. Co-driver Toussaint Capocchi managed to escape from the burning car. René Zereni was burned to death.

After the tragedy, the event was immediately stopped. The rally was titled as "Souvenir Simon Quilici ", in memory of the French rally co-driver who was killed on 09 October 1982, during a reconnaissance session, in sight of the Ronde Automobile de Calvi. Ironically, Camille Bartoli in his Renault 5 Turbo was the winner on both the editions of the event.
